This is basically a wrapper for mysql_stmt_attr_set in the MySQL C API: http://dev.mysql.com/doc/refman/5.0/en/mysql-stmt-attr-set.htmlmysqli_stmt::attr_set
Почист и полокален преглед на PHP референцата, со задржана структура од PHP.net и подобра читливост за примери, секции и белешки.
mysqli_stmt::attr_set
Референца за `mysqli-stmt.attr-set.php` со подобрена типографија и навигација.
mysqli_stmt::attr_set
mysqli_stmt_attr_set
класата mysqli_driver
mysqli_stmt::attr_set -- mysqli_stmt_attr_set — Се користи за модифицирање на однесувањето на подготвениот исказ
= NULL
Напиши целосна ознака на елемент
Процедурален стил
Се користи за модифицирање на однесувањето на подготвената изјава. Оваа функција може да се повика повеќе пати за да се постават неколку атрибути.
Параметри
-
statement - објектот како свој прв аргумент. mysqli_stmt Само процедурален стил: А mysqli_stmt_init().
attribute-
Атрибутот што сакате да го поставите. Може да има една од следниве вредности:
Вредности на атрибутите Извршени преводи = NULL MYSQLI_STMT_ATTR_UPDATE_MAX_LENGTH Поставување на truecauses mysqli_stmt_store_result() за ажурирање на метаподатоцитеMYSQL_FIELD->max_lengthvalue.MYSQLI_STMT_ATTR_CURSOR_TYPE Тип на курсор што треба да се отвори за изјавата кога mysqli_stmt_execute() се повикува. valueможе да бидеMYSQLI_CURSOR_TYPE_NO_CURSOR(стандардно) илиMYSQLI_CURSOR_TYPE_READ_ONLY.MYSQLI_STMT_ATTR_PREFETCH_ROWS Број на редови што треба да се преземат од серверот одеднаш кога се користи курсор. valueможе да биде во опсег од 1 до максималната вредност на unsigned long. Стандардно е 1. Отстрането од PHP 8.4.0.Ако го користите
MYSQLI_STMT_ATTR_CURSOR_TYPEопцијата соMYSQLI_CURSOR_TYPE_READ_ONLY, курсорот се отвора за изјавата кога ќе го повикате mysqli_stmt_execute(). Ако веќе постои отворен курсор од претходен mysqli_stmt_execute() повик, курсорот се затвора пред да се отвори нов. mysqli_stmt_reset() исто така затвора кој било отворен курсор пред да ја подготви изјавата за повторно извршување. mysqli_stmt_free_result() затвора кој било отворен курсор.Ако отворите курсор за подготвена изјава, mysqli_stmt_store_result() не е потребно.
value-
Вредноста што треба да се додели на атрибутот.
Вратени вредности
Патеката до PHP скриптата што треба да се провери. true на успех или false при неуспех.
Errors/Exceptions
Ако е овозможено известување за грешки на mysqli (MYSQLI_REPORT_ERROR) и бараната операција не успее, се генерира предупредување. Ако, дополнително, режимот е поставен на MYSQLI_REPORT_STRICT, а mysqli_sql_exception наместо тоа се фрла.